The company offers various types of lasers; on the forum, the ones which have attracted the most attention are the beam-combining RG:Y and RB:M lasers and the high-power 532s.

XPL will be introducing a new host for their high-powered 532nm lasers soon. It will be $10-20 more expensive, and will have features such as focusing, analog modulation, pulsing, star caps, and password switch. They told me that the NiMH batteries are used to reduce the heat. I think it's necessary in order to keep the duty cycle from becoming absurdly short. I don't like it either, but it beats the alternative.

Most decent Li-ion round cell chargers can handle NiMH quite well, including mine.
http://laserpointerforums.com/f52/nitecore-d4-digicharger-review-97100.html

The driver on these things must just not be able to take the higher voltage. It must max out before 4.2V as a few high power IR drivers do.
